The Use of Internet of Things (IoT) in Supply Chain Process

iot in supply chain

The adoption of IoT in supply chain is transforming how businesses manage logistics, inventory, and distribution in the Industry 4.0 era. As global supply chains become increasingly complex, companies need real-time visibility and data-driven decision-making to improve efficiency, reduce operational costs, and respond quickly to disruptions.

By connecting physical assets through smart sensors and internet-enabled devices, IoT enables businesses to build more agile, transparent, and intelligent supply chain operations.

What is the Internet of Things (IoT)?

The Internet of Things (IoT) is a network of physical devices connected to the internet that can collect, exchange, and analyze data with minimal human intervention. Using sensors, RFID tags, GPS, and other connected technologies, IoT enables machines, equipment, and assets to communicate with one another in real time.

In industrial operations, IoT is widely used to automate processes, monitor equipment performance, improve predictive maintenance, and optimize supply chain management through continuous data collection and analysis.

Why IoT is Important in Supply Chain Management

Modern supply chains involve multiple stakeholders, warehouses, transportation networks, and suppliers spread across different regions. Without real-time visibility, businesses often struggle with inventory inaccuracies, shipment delays, and inefficient resource allocation.

Implementing IoT in supply chain management allows companies to gain end-to-end visibility across every stage of the supply chain. Connected devices continuously monitor assets, inventory, and transportation conditions, enabling faster decision-making, reducing manual processes, and improving overall operational performance.

Applications of IoT in Supply Chain Management

Automatic logistics

1. Asset Tracking

Supply chain management is transformed by IoT’s ability to track asset locations. Connected sensors provide continuous information about product locations, movement history, and lifecycle status. Businesses can optimize delivery routes, prevent shipment delays, and reduce losses while improving supply chain efficiency.

2. Fleet Management

IoT sensors installed in delivery vehicles collect valuable operational data, including speed, fuel consumption, emissions, engine condition, and tire pressure. This information supports predictive maintenance, reduces unexpected vehicle breakdowns, improves driver safety, and enables more accurate delivery scheduling.

3. Warehouse Management

Warehouse operations become significantly more efficient with IoT-enabled automation. Smart sensors placed on shelves, pallets, and storage areas monitor inventory movement in real time, helping reduce human error, improve stock accuracy, prevent inventory shortages, and accelerate order fulfillment.

4. Cold Chain Monitoring

Temperature-sensitive products such as pharmaceuticals, food, and vaccines require strict environmental control throughout transportation. IoT sensors continuously monitor temperature, humidity, and air quality, instantly alerting operators whenever conditions exceed acceptable limits. This helps maintain product quality while reducing spoilage and waste.

Benefits of IoT in Supply Chain

Beyond improving operational visibility, IoT delivers several long-term business advantages.

1. Improved Real-Time Visibility

Connected devices provide instant updates across the entire supply chain, allowing businesses to quickly identify disruptions and respond before they escalate.

2. Better Inventory Accuracy

Real-time inventory tracking reduces stock discrepancies, minimizes overstocking and stockouts, and supports more accurate demand forecasting.

3. Lower Operational Costs

Automation reduces manual data entry, minimizes errors, optimizes transportation routes, and lowers maintenance expenses through predictive analytics.

4. Enhanced Customer Satisfaction

More accurate shipment tracking and reliable delivery estimates improve customer experience while increasing trust and transparency.

5. Data-Driven Decision Making

IoT generates valuable operational insights that help companies identify inefficiencies, improve planning, and optimize overall supply chain performance.

The Future of IoT in Supply Chain

As Industry 4.0 continues to evolve, IoT is becoming the foundation of digital supply chains. Emerging technologies such as Artificial Intelligence (AI), machine learning, digital twins, and cloud computing are increasingly integrated with IoT platforms to create autonomous and predictive supply chain ecosystems.

In the future, businesses will rely even more on connected technologies to improve resilience, reduce supply chain risks, and enhance sustainability through smarter resource utilization and energy-efficient logistics operations.
